In a given square ABCD, if the area of triangle ABD is 36cm2, find (i) the area of triangle BCD; (ii) the area of the square ABCD

Consider a square ABCD,
According to the problem, it is given that the area of ΔABD is 36cm2.
We know that the diagonal of a square bisect into congruent triangles.
So, from the figure we can clearly say that
Area of ΔABD = Area of ΔBCD
So, Area of ΔBCD = 36cm2.
From the figure, we can clearly say that,
Area of square ABCD = Area of ΔABD + Area of ΔBCD
Area of square ABCD = 36 + 36cm2
Area of square ABCD = 72cm2.
The Area of ΔBCD = 36cm2.
The Area of square ABCD = 72cm2.
